BS Textile Management and Technology is an undergraduate course of four years, which will equip students with skills to manage and control the textile and apparel industries at leadership positions. It is a program that integrates management with technical knowhows of textile production, as well as, marketing and business. This degree is becoming popular in Pakistan because the textile industry in the country is a significant contributor to the economy and one of the largest employers. The 2026 admissions will be competitive, as the demand towards skilled professionals in the textile manufacturing, quality control, supply chain management and product development will be on the rise. The aim of the universities that offer this program is to equip the students with the theoretical and practical experience with a view to producing students who are well prepared to address the increasing demands of the textile market.

In order to be eligible to apply to BS Textile Management and Technology in 2026, the candidates should have successfully completed Intermediate (FSc Pre-Engineering, ICS, and similar) with at least 50% marks . There are also universities, which accept students with A-Levels or DAE ( Diploma of Associate Engineering ) in related disciplines. The applicants should also possess a strong mathematical and science background because this is the foundation of textile engineering and management courses. Some institutions might also demand entry test or interview to evaluate the aptitude of the candidate to the program. It is recommended that students should check the requirements of particular university admission policies.
The process of admission of BS Textile Management and Technology typically starts with the filling of an online application using the official university portal. The applicants are required to post their education documents, photographs, and cnic or B-Form with the application fee. Merit lists are released, after the first screening, according to academic results and entry test results (where applicable) by universities. The successful candidates are then supposed to hand in the original papers to be checked and make payment of the admission fee to secure the seat. Many universities will also be providing online application facilities to facilitate the process to students in Pakistan in the case of 2026 admissions.

The admission criteria is computed as a sum of marks in matriculation, intermediate and entry test results (where necessary). Universities run by the government typically use 70-80% weightage of the intermediate marks, 10-20% of matriculation and the rest to the entry test. Instead of written examination, intermediate marks and interviews can be used as the main source of admission in private universities. The merit in the 2026 is likely to be competitive and particularly in leading universities such as National Textile University (NTU) Faisalabad, University of Management and Technology (UMT) and other institutes that offer courses in the textile field. Students who perform well in the science and mathematics subjects are better placed to get admission.
The major of BS Textile Management and Technology provides a great variety of career options. The graduates are able to work as managers in textile production, as quality control officers, supply chain executives, merchandisers, and research analysts. The degree is also equipped to equip the students with entrepreneurship in the textile and apparel business. Pakistan is among the largest exporters of textile therefore there is always demand of skilled professionals in the same field both locally and internationally.
